8085 cpu architecture pdf

The 8085 chip is 8bit general purpose microprocessor which. Program, data and stack memories occupy the same memory space. The 8085 and address ranges now, we can break up the 16bit address of the 8085 into two pieces. Features of 8085 intel 8085 is an 8bit, nmos microprocessor. Oct, 2012 the 8085 and address ranges now, we can break up the 16bit address of the 8085 into two pieces. It processes the data as required in the instructions. Intel 8085 is an 8bit, nmos microprocessor designed by intel in 1977. Editorial content, 8805 as news and celebrity images, are not cleared for commercial use. The 8085 is an 8bit general purpose microprocessor that can address 64k byte of memory. Week 2 architecture of 8085 week 3 addressing modes and instruction set of 8085 week 4 interrupts of. As the most of the processor instructions use 16bit pointers the processor can effectively address only 64 kb of memory. For the love of physics walter lewin may 16, 2011 duration. It is an 8bit microprocessor designed by intel in 1977 using nmos technology.

Microprocessor 8085 architecture in microprocessor tutorial. Flags, interrupts, instruction register and decoders,arithmetic and logic unit and various other units explained in detail. Opcodes table of intel 8085 opcodes of intel 8085 in alphabetical order. T o the software engineer, the 8085 was essentially the same as the 8080. The time for the back cycle of the intel 8085 a2 is 200 ns. Architecture of intel 8085 microprocessor data accumulator r. Instruction set of 8085 an instruction is a binary pattern designed inside a microprocessor to perform a specific function. Motorola s 6800 series was easier to program, mos t echnologies. Learn in detail about the architecture of 8085 microprocessor. Introduction fundamentals of microprocessor 8085 and. Each instruction is represented by an 8bit binary value. Microprocessor architecture and its operations lecture 2. A microprocessor is an integrated circuit designed to function as the cpu of a microcomputer. Intel 8085 8bit microprocessor intel 8085 is an 8bit, nmos microprocessor.

Appreciate the detailed explanation about 8085 architecture. However, the 8085 had lots of hardware improvements that made it easier to design into a circuit. The ebook has complete chapters on microprocessor and it is. Here, we will describe intel 8085 as it is one of the most popular 8bit microprocessor. Clock oscillator and system controller were integrated. It is the set of instructions that the microprocessor can understand. Why would one want to name entirely different things with the same name. Opcodes of 8085 microprocessor it is a large and heavy desktop box, about a 20. Before knowing about the 8085 architecture in detail, lets us briefly discuss about the basic features of 8085 processor 8085 microprocessor is an 8bit microprocessor with a 40 pin dual in line package. The intel 8085 eightyeightyfive is an 8bit microprocessor produced by intel and introduced in march 1976. Products 1 30 opcode sheet for 8085 microprocessor with descriptiondownload as text file. The address and data bus are multiplexed in this processor which helps in providing more control signals. This architecture, as outlined above, is very different from that of 80858080 and quite similar, but more powerful z80.

The internal architecture of 8085 includes the alu, timing and control unit, instruction register and decoder, register array, interrupt control and serial io control. To access memory outside of 64 kb the cpu uses special segment registers to specify where the code, stack and data 64 kb segments are positioned within 1 mb of memory see the registers section below. Jump, branch and call instructions use 16bit addresses. Introduction to microprocessor 6 the 8085 interrupts the 8085 has 5 interrupt inputs. Lecture note on microprocessor and microcontroller theory. A microprocessor is an integrated circuit with all the functions of a cpu however, it cannot be used stand alone since unlike a microcontroller it has no memory or peripherals 8086 does not have a ram or rom inside it. In this article you will get to know about the definition, architecture, block diagram and working of 8085 microprocessor. This book was first published in 1984 and it has been in the field for nearly three decades. Intel 8086 architecture chapter 2 major features of 8086 processor, 808688 cpu architecture. The microprocessor is the cpu central processing unit of a computer. Program memory program can be located anywhere in memory. The data bus is a group of lines used to carry the data between various components of microcomputer.

However, it requires less support circuitry, allowing simpler and less expensive microcomputer systems to be built. The processing is in the form of arithmetic and logical operations. Microprocessor architecture,programming and applications with the 8085 by ramesh gaonkar provides a comprehensive treatment of the microprocessor,covering both hardware and software based on the 8085 microprocessor family. The 8080 processor was updated with enabledisable instruction pins and interrupt pins to form the 8085 microprocessor. To perform addition of two 8 bit numbers using 8085. Actually, call instructions could be issued in response to an interrupt, but the circuitry to do so was rather complex and it had to be implemented outside the cpu. As discussed earlier, 8085 microprocessor was introduced by intel in the year 1976. Cpu central processing unit alu arithmeticlogic unit control logic registers, etc memory input output interfaces processor system architecture interconnections between these units. However, it has internal registers for storing intermediate and final results and interfaces with memory located outside it through the system bus. Let us understand 8085 microprocessor architecture with its internal modules or units. Lecture note on microprocessor and microcontroller theory and.

This microprocessor is an update of 8080 microprocessor. Cpu ar chitecture chapter four plantation productions, inc. The microprocessor is one of most known subject is computer engineering branch. Unfortunately, from a software perspective the other manufacturer s of ferings were better. The entire group of instructions that a microprocessor supports is called instruction set. It determines the number of operations per second the processor can perform. Intel 8085 microprocessor is the next generation of intel 8080 cpu family. It is an 8bit microprocessor which was introduced by intel in the year 1976 using nmos technology. In intel 8085, there is 16bit address, so it has capability of addressing memory up to 64 kb. The microprocessor or cpu reads each instruction from the memory, decodes it and executes it. Central processing unit cpu is carved on a single chip is called a microprocessor.

Internal architecture of 8085 microprocessor learn about. The 8085 in cludes on its chip most of the logic circuitry for per forming computing tasks and for communicating with peripherals. Tutorial on introduction to 8085 architecture and programming. The microprocessor based system consist of microprocessor as cpu. It is the number of bits processed in a single instruction. Ppt the 8085 microprocessor architecture powerpoint. Also learn about why the flags in microprocessor are called as flags. The major features of 8085 chip are 8 bit data bus, 16 bit address bus, 3.

And, yes, the 8085 is an 8bit cpu, while the 8086 is 16bit. It is a softwarebinary compatible with the morefamous intel 8080 with only two minor instructions added to support its added interrupt and serial inputoutput features. In this article you will get to know about the definition, architecture, block diagram and working of. Reduced instruction set computer risc processors complex instruction set computer cisc processors 2. Pdf chapter 4 8085 microprocessor architecture and memory. Goankar, microprocessor architecture, programming and applications with 8085, 5th edition, prentice hall week 1 basic concept and ideas about microprocessor. This is why most implementations used rst instructions to vector control to the interrupt service routine. It is a 40 pin c package fabricated on a single lsi chip. The functional components of a cpu are arithmetic logic unit alu, control and timing units, registers are found in a single integrated circuit called ic. Architecture, programming, and interfacing, this book is designed as a firstlevel introduction to microprocessor 8085, covering its architecture, programming, and interfacing aspects. A15 a14 a a12 a11 a10 a9 a8 a7 a6 a5 a4 a3 a2 a1 a0 chip selection location selection within the chip depending on the combination on the address lines a15 a10, the address range of the specified chip is determined. Let us discuss the architecture of 8085 microprocessor in detail.